Canadian business immigration is aimed at applicants who wish to obtain a Canada immigration visa and who possess a minimum of funds and have business or management experience.
Selected applicants under the business immigration program and immediate family members will receive canadian permanent resident status. After three years of residence in Canada, a business immigrant as well as his family members will become eligible to apply for Canadian citizenship.
There are 3 categories of Canada business immigration:
Entrepreneur Immigration
Applicants in this category must be able to prove a minimum net worth of CAD$300,000 and must have managed and owned a legitimate business for at least 2 years within the last 5 years. Accepted entrepreneur immigrant will have to establish and manage on a daily basis a Canadian business within three years of becoming a permanent resident of Canada.
Investor Immigration
Applicants in this category must be able to prove a minimum net worth of CAD$1,600,000 and must have managed and owned a legitimate business for at least 2 years within the last 5 years. Accepted applicants are required to make a secured investment with the Canadian immigration authorities of CAD$800,000, a part of which may be financed.
Self-employed Immigration
Applicants in this category must be able to prove a minimum net worth of CAD$100,000 and must have a minimum of 2 years of business experience as a self employed.
